Why do we need a private subnet?

It's a security boundary to have a private subnet that you can control with different security groups from the public subnet. If one of your instances in the public subnet were hacked, it will be that much more difficult to hack into instances in the private subnet if you are not too liberal in your access policies.

What is a private subnet vs public subnet?

A public subnet has a route table that says, “send all outbound traffic (anything to the CIDR block 0.0. 0.0/0) via this internet gateway.” A private subnet either does not allow outbound traffic to the internet or has a route that says, “send all outbound traffic via this NAT gateway.”

Why would a VPC use private and public subnets?

The instances in the public subnet can send outbound traffic directly to the internet, whereas the instances in the private subnet can't. Instead, the instances in the private subnet can access the internet by using a network address translation (NAT) gateway that resides in the public subnet.

How do you identify a private subnet?

So, to determine if a given subnet is public or private, you need to describe the route table that is associated with that subnet. That will tell you the routes and you can test for a 0.0. 0.0/0 route with a gateway ID of igw-x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x (as opposed to local ). Here, you can see a destination route of 0.0.

How is a public subnet connected to a private subnet?

Nat Gateway: A Nat Gateway enables instances in private subnets to connect to the internet. The Nat gateway must be deployed in the public subnet with an Elastic IP. Once the resource is created, a route table associated with the the private subnet needs to point internet-bound traffic to the NAT gateway.

How do I create a private subnet in default VPC?

You can make a default subnet into a private subnet by removing the route from the destination 0.0. 0.0/0 to the internet gateway. However, if you do this, no EC2 instance running in that subnet can access the internet.

Which IP address should you not use in your private network?

In April 2012, IANA allocated the block 100.64.0.0/10 (100.64.0.0 to 100.127.255.255, netmask 255.192.0.0) for use in carrier-grade NAT scenarios. This address block should not be used on private networks or on the public Internet.

Can 1 VPC have multiple subnets?

If you create more than one subnet in a VPC, the CIDR blocks of the subnets cannot overlap. For example, if you create a VPC with CIDR block 10.0. 0.0/24 , it supports 256 IP addresses. You can break this CIDR block into two subnets, each supporting 128 IP addresses.
